i just happened to wonder if there is a user-level
file server which serves the classic pcfs file system.
i have an old 3rd ed. file system and copying all
of its /n/dump to new venti is time consuming.

If by pcfs you mean the old worm file server
running 9pcfs, there's no user-level version.
It probably wouldn't be too much work to move
into user space (that's how kfs happened, though
kfs drops the interesting bits) but it hasn't
been done.
